- The “Fatigue Factor” and Surgical Precision
High-quality hair transplants involve moving thousands of tiny grafts over 6 to 10 hours. That’s a marathon, not a sprint.The Traditional Approach: By hour 5 or 6, even the most skilled surgeon or technician naturally experiences fatigue. This can lead to small tremors or “micromovements” that damage delicate follicles, or rushed angulation that leaves hairs pointing in unnatural directions.
The 3-Doctor Advantage: With three surgeons rotating responsibilities, every single graft gets handled with “first hour energy.” The surgeon working on your hairline at hour 5 is just as fresh and precise as the one who started at hour 1.
- Beating the “Ischemia Time” (The 6-Hour Rule)
Here’s something important to understand: hair grafts are living tissue. The moment they’re removed from your blood supply, the clock starts ticking.
The Science: Research shows that graft survival rates drop significantly the longer your hair grafts are disconnected from your blood supply. We discussed in depth in The 6-Hour Rule. Without oxygen and moisture, follicles weaken, leading to poor growth or “shock loss” down the road.
Our Advantage: 3 doctors working together can complete a large session (say, 3,000 grafts) much faster than a single surgeon could. This isn’t about rushing, it’s about efficient teamwork that keeps your grafts in the “safe zone” for maximum viability.
- Medical Accountability vs Technician Risk
In many clinics worldwide, technicians perform much of the actual surgery and in some places, this is actually illegal. While technicians can be skilled, they lack the medical training to handle complications.
The Risk: If a technician implants a hair too deep, you might end up with “pitting” (small depressions in the skin). Too shallow? The graft dies, causing “cobblestoning.”
The 3-Doctor Guarantee: Only certified doctors perform your hair transplant. They understand scalp anatomy, nerve depth, and blood supply inside and out, dramatically reducing your risk of tissue death and infection.

What is the "6-Hour Rule" and why is it critical for my results?
Hair grafts are living organs. Once extracted from your scalp, they are cut off from their blood supply. Clinical studies show that survival rates for these grafts drop significantly the longer they remain disconnected for your scalps blood supply. By using three doctors working in a “symphony of efficiency,” we can complete large graft sessions within this safe window, drastically reducing the risk of graft death and ensuring a denser final result.
